Auckland pharmacy owner Tania Adams says the public appear to be aware of the ongoing shortage of influenza vaccines

An unprecedented number of Kiwis have had flu jabs this year; so many that the national stock of vaccine has been exhausted. In response, the Ministry of Health is asking vaccinators to limit vaccinations to high-risk populations and share stock among themselves. Reporter Jonathan Chilton-Towle finds out how pharmacists are coping during the shortage
